在移动互联网时代,拥有一个响应式手机网站对于企业或个人来说至关重要。JavaServer Pages(JSP)技术因其跨平台性和易用性,成为了搭建手机网站的热门选择。本文将详细介绍如何使用JSP技术轻松搭建手机网站,并针对常见问题进行解析。
一、JSP技术简介
JSP是一种动态网页技术,允许开发者在HTML页面中嵌入Java代码。当请求JSP页面时,服务器会自动将JSP代码编译成Java Servlet,执行后生成HTML页面返回给客户端。这使得JSP在开发动态网站时具有很高的灵活性和可扩展性。
二、搭建手机网站的准备工作
1. 开发环境搭建
- Java Development Kit (JDK):下载并安装JDK,确保版本与JSP容器兼容。
- Web服务器:安装并配置Tomcat等Web服务器,用于运行JSP页面。
- 集成开发环境 (IDE):选择合适的IDE,如Eclipse、IntelliJ IDEA等,提高开发效率。
2. 了解HTML和CSS
在开发手机网站时,需要熟悉HTML和CSS,以便设计页面布局和样式。
3. 学习JSP基本语法
- JSP标签:了解JSP中的内置标签和自定义标签。
- EL表达式:学习使用表达式语言(EL)访问Java对象。
- JSP指令:了解页面指令、会话指令和包含指令。
三、实战教程
1. 创建项目
在IDE中创建一个新的Java Web项目,并配置Web服务器。
2. 设计页面布局
使用HTML和CSS设计手机网站的页面布局,包括头部、导航栏、内容区域和底部。
3. 编写JSP页面
在项目下创建JSP文件,如index.jsp,编写页面逻辑代码。
<%@ page contentType="text/html;charset=UTF-8" language="java" %>
<html>
<head>
<title>手机网站</title>
<link rel="stylesheet" type="text/css" href="styles.css">
</head>
<body>
<div class="header">
<h1>欢迎来到我的手机网站</h1>
</div>
<div class="content">
<h2>关于我</h2>
<p>这里是关于我的介绍...</p>
</div>
<div class="footer">
<p>版权所有 © 2023</p>
</div>
</body>
</html>
4. 部署和测试
将项目部署到Web服务器,并在浏览器中访问JSP页面,确保网站功能正常。
四、常见问题解析
1. JSP页面无法访问
原因:可能是Web服务器未正确配置或JSP文件路径错误。
解决方案:
- 检查Web服务器配置,确保JSP页面路径正确。
- 确认JSP文件编码格式与服务器一致。
2. JSP页面加载缓慢
原因:可能是服务器性能不足或页面代码过于复杂。
解决方案:
- 优化服务器性能,如增加服务器资源或使用更快的Web服务器。
- 优化JSP页面代码,如减少嵌套、合并重复代码等。
3. JSP页面无法显示中文
原因:可能是JSP文件编码格式与服务器不一致。
解决方案:
- 设置JSP文件编码格式为UTF-8。
- 确保服务器支持UTF-8编码。
五、总结
使用JSP技术搭建手机网站是一个简单而高效的过程。通过本文的实战教程和常见问题解析,相信您已经掌握了使用JSP搭建手机网站的方法。祝您在移动互联网领域取得成功!
